织梦CMS(DedeCMS)作为国内广泛使用的开源内容管理系统,其模板安装是网站搭建中的关键环节,HTML5模板因其语义化标签、良好的移动端适配能力和加载速度优势,成为越来越多用户的选择,本文将详细介绍织梦HTML5模板的安装步骤、注意事项及常见问题解决,帮助用户顺利完成模板部署,确保网站正常运行。

安装前的准备工作
在开始安装织梦HTML5模板前,需完成以下准备工作,避免因环境不匹配或文件缺失导致安装失败:
确认织梦CMS版本兼容性
织梦模板需与CMS版本匹配,目前主流织梦版本为DedeCMS 5.7、5.8及后续版本,HTML5模板通常支持织梦V5.7及以上版本,建议用户优先选择与当前织梦版本完全兼容的模板,避免因版本差异导致功能异常,可通过织梦官网或模板提供方确认兼容性说明。
检查服务器环境
织梦CMS运行需满足基础服务器环境要求,具体包括:
- PHP版本:建议PHP 7.0-7.4版本(部分高版本模板可能支持PHP 8.0,但需注意织梦核心对PHP 8.0的兼容性,可通过PHPinfo()函数查看当前PHP版本);
- MySQL版本:建议MySQL 5.6及以上版本;
- 服务器软件:支持Apache(需开启mod_rewrite模块)或Nginx(需配置伪静态规则);
- 权限设置:确保网站根目录(通常是public_html或www)及子目录(如/data、/templets)具有755权限,文件具有644权限(可通过FTP工具或服务器控制面板设置)。
备份原网站数据
安装新模板前,务必备份原网站数据,包括:
- 数据库备份:通过织梦后台“系统”-“数据库备份/还原”功能导出数据库,或通过phpMyAdmin手动导出;
- 文件备份:通过FTP工具下载网站根目录所有文件,尤其是/templets(模板目录)、/data(配置目录)及/uploads(附件目录);
- 配置文件备份:备份/data/common.inc.php(数据库配置文件)及/plus/config.php(附件配置文件)。
备份操作可有效避免安装过程中数据丢失或模板冲突,方便快速恢复原网站。
下载并解压HTML5模板包
从正规渠道(如织梦官方模板市场、授权模板开发商)下载HTML5模板包,模板包通常包含以下文件:
- 模板文件(如/templets/default/目录,包含index.html、list_html、article_html等模板文件);
- 静态资源文件(如/css/、/js/、/images/等目录,存放样式表、脚本及图片);
- 安装说明文档(如install.txt或readme.txt,部分模板需特殊安装步骤);
- 模板标签文件(如/templets/system/目录,可能包含自定义标签文件)。
下载后,通过解压工具(如WinRAR、7-Zip)将模板包解压至本地,方便后续文件上传。
织梦HTML5模板安装详细步骤
完成准备工作后,即可开始模板安装,以下是通用安装步骤,部分特殊模板(如带模块化安装的)可能需额外操作,需结合模板说明文档进行调整。
上传模板文件至服务器
织梦模板默认存放于网站根目录下的/templets/文件夹中,若模板名称为“default”,可直接覆盖原default文件夹;若为自定义名称(如“html5”),需上传至/templets/目录下,并在后台切换模板。
操作步骤:
- 通过FTP工具(如FileZilla)连接服务器,登录网站根目录;
- 找到/templets/文件夹,将解压后的模板文件夹(如“html5”)上传至该目录;
- 若模板包含静态资源文件(如/css/style.css、/js/main.js),确保其路径与模板文件中的引用路径一致(模板文件中路径通常为“{dede:global.cfg_templets_skin/}/css/style.css”,dede:global.cfg_templets_skin/}会自动替换为当前模板目录)。
上传并替换核心文件(部分模板需操作)
部分HTML5模板可能包含织梦核心文件的修改版本(如/include/目录下的文件、/index.php等),用于支持HTML5标签或新增功能,若模板说明中提示“需替换核心文件”,需谨慎操作:
操作步骤:

- 备份原核心文件(如/include/arc.archives.class.php、/include/common.inc.php等);
- 按照模板包中的“核心文件修改说明”,上传对应的修改文件至对应目录;
- 替换后,需检查文件权限是否正确(通常为644),避免因权限问题导致功能异常。
配置模板并设置默认风格
上传模板文件后,需在织梦后台将新模板设置为默认风格,并完成基础配置:
操作步骤:
- 登录织梦后台(域名/dede/),进入“系统”-“系统基本参数”-“默认模板风格”;
- 在“默认模板风格”输入框中填入模板文件夹名称(如“html5”),点击“保存”;
- 若模板包含多个风格(如“默认”“深色”),可在“模板管理”中切换风格,或通过后台“风格管理”功能添加新风格。
更新数据库及缓存(部分模板需执行)
部分HTML5模板可能新增了自定义字段、模块或菜单项,需通过织梦数据库工具更新数据结构,或执行SQL语句(模板包中通常提供.sql文件):
操作步骤:
- 若模板包中包含“install.sql”或“data.sql”文件,通过phpMyAdmin登录数据库,选择对应网站数据库,点击“导入”,上传该SQL文件;
- 导入完成后,返回织梦后台,进入“系统”-“系统设置”-“SQL命令行工具”,执行模板提供的SQL语句(如更新栏目字段、添加广告位等);
- 执行完毕后,在后台“生成”-“更新缓存”中点击“一键更新缓存”,清除旧缓存文件,确保新模板生效。
设置伪静态规则(提升SEO体验)
HTML5模板通常需配合伪静态规则,以提升网站加载速度和SEO友好度,根据服务器类型(Apache/Nginx),需配置不同的伪静态规则:
Apache服务器伪静态规则:
Nginx服务器伪静态规则:
验证模板安装效果
完成上述步骤后,需通过前台和后台验证模板是否正常显示:
前台验证:
- 访问网站首页,检查页面布局、样式、图片是否正常显示;
- 测试栏目页、文章页、搜索页等关键页面,确保HTML5标签(如
- 检查移动端适配效果(通过浏览器开发者工具切换移动设备模式),确保响应式布局正常。
后台验证:
- 检查后台“模板管理”中是否显示新模板,且可正常编辑模板文件;
- 测试新增功能(如自定义字段、模块调用)是否生效;
- 查看“系统日志”是否有报错信息,及时排查问题。
安装后常见问题及解决方法
模板安装过程中,可能会遇到样式丢失、页面报错、功能异常等问题,以下是常见问题及解决思路:
首页样式丢失或错位
原因:

- 模板文件路径错误(如CSS、JS文件引用路径不正确);
- 静态资源文件未上传至服务器或路径不匹配;
- 模板缓存未更新,导致调用旧样式。
解决方法:
- 检查模板文件中CSS/JS引用路径,确保使用“{dede:global.cfg_templets_skin/}”变量(如);
- 通过FTP工具确认静态资源文件是否上传至对应目录(如/templets/html5/css/);
- 进入后台“生成”-“更新缓存”,点击“一键更新缓存”,清除所有缓存文件。
后台无法进入或报错“模板文件不存在”
原因:
- 模板文件夹名称错误(如后台设置的模板名称与实际文件夹名称不一致);
- /templets/目录权限不足(无法读取模板文件);
- 模板文件损坏或缺失(如index.html文件未上传)。
解决方法:
- 进入后台“系统基本参数”,检查“默认模板风格”是否与/templets/下的文件夹名称一致(区分大小写);
- 通过FTP工具设置/templets/目录权限为755,模板文件权限为644;
- 重新上传模板文件,确保核心文件(如index.html、head.htm)完整。
HTML5标签未生效,页面显示为普通标签
原因:
- 织梦版本过低(不支持HTML5标签);
- 模板文件未使用织梦HTML5标签语法(如未调用{dede:include filename="head.htm"/});
- 浏览器缓存问题,未加载新模板文件。
解决方法:
- 升级织梦CMS至V5.7及以上版本(低版本需手动修改/include/dedetemplate.class.php文件支持HTML5,但操作复杂,建议升级版本);
- 检查模板文件是否使用织梦标签语法,确保HTML5标签与织梦标签结合正确(如);
- 清除浏览器缓存(Ctrl+F5强制刷新)或使用无痕模式访问网站。
数据库导入失败或报错
原因:
- 数据库权限不足(无法执行导入操作);
- SQL文件编码格式不匹配(如模板SQL文件为UTF-8 BOM格式,而数据库为GBK);
- 数据表中已存在重复数据(如栏目ID冲突)。
解决方法:
- 通过phpMyAdmin检查数据库用户权限,确保拥有“SELECT, INSERT, UPDATE, DELETE, CREATE, ALTER, DROP”等权限;
- 将SQL文件转换为与数据库一致的编码格式(如使用EditPlus或Notepad++打开SQL文件,另存为“UTF-8无BOM格式”);
- 若存在重复数据,先删除原数据再导入,或修改SQL文件中的表前缀(如将“dede”改为“网站前缀”)。
注意事项与最佳实践
为确保织梦HTML5模板长期稳定运行,需注意以下事项,遵循最佳实践:
选择正规模板渠道
避免从非正规网站下载免费模板,此类模板可能包含恶意代码(如后门、垃圾链接),威胁网站安全,建议通过织梦官方模板市场(http://templets.dedecms.com/)、授权模板开发商或知名开源社区购买/下载模板,并确认模板提供方提供售后支持。
定期更新模板与核心程序
织梦官方会不定期发布安全补丁和功能更新,HTML5模板开发商也可能针对兼容性问题发布模板升级包,用户需关注官方动态,及时更新模板和核心程序,修复潜在安全漏洞(如SQL注入、XSS攻击)。
遵守模板版权协议
部分HTML5模板需保留版权信息(如底部 powered by 模板名称),用户不得随意删除或修改,若需去除版权,需联系模板购买方获取授权,避免法律纠纷。
模板二次开发需谨慎
若需对HTML5模板进行二次开发(如修改样式、新增功能),建议备份原模板文件,避免直接修改核心文件,可通过织梦“模板管理”中的“在线编辑”功能修改模板,或使用Dreamweaver等专业工具编辑,修改后及时更新缓存。
关注网站性能优化
HTML5模板虽具备性能优势,但仍需优化细节:压缩CSS/JS文件(使用工具如CSSMinifier、JSCompressor)、启用浏览器缓存(通过.htaccess或Nginx配置)、使用CDN加速静态资源等,进一步提升网站加载速度。
织梦HTML5模板的安装需严格遵循“准备-上传-配置-验证”的流程,重点关注版本兼容性、文件路径、权限设置及伪静态规则,安装过程中遇到问题时,优先通过备份文件恢复,并结合模板说明文档和织梦官方社区排查原因,选择正规模板渠道、定期更新维护、遵守版权协议,是确保网站安全稳定运行的关键,通过以上步骤,用户可顺利完成织梦HTML5模板安装,搭建出符合现代Web标准的优质网站。
引用说明参考织梦CMS官方文档(https://help.dedecms.com/)、HTML5模板技术规范及资深开发者实践经验,旨在提供准确、可操作的安装指南,具体操作时,请结合所用模板的说明文档及服务器环境进行调整。